基本普段はG Suiteユーザなので、以前ほどVBAを弄らなくなりましたが、会社では通信環境や開発環境が2000年レベルで制限されているので、VBAがいつまでも現役です。ウェブアプリケーション全盛の今でもVBAが現役で使えるのは、Web APIへアクセスする手段が昔からの手法で可能な面が大きいですね。 さて、そんなウェブサービスの一つに「Box」というストレージサービスがあります。正直一般ユーザではメジャーでもなんでもありません。また機能面でもGoogle Driveのほうが断然扱いやすく、学習コストも低い。このサービスもAPIがありますが、その情報源はほとんどが海外。とは言え、使わざるを得ない状況なので、VBAからAPIを使えるようにチャレンジしてみました。 ※Access Token取得部分(getAccessToken, getNewToken)にて、urlencodeのheader
![VBAからBox APIを叩いてみる – 準備編 🌴 officeの杜 🥥](https://cdn-ak-scissors.b.st-hatena.com/image/square/3d6ec9351b4f58c8e2b1a4f3b119438ebd37d82d/height=288;version=1;width=512/https%3A%2F%2Fofficeforest.org%2Fwp%2Fwp-content%2Fuploads%2F2018%2F10%2Fboxauth.jpg)